Understanding legacy systems in today’s business environment
In the rapidly evolving landscape of business technology, many organizations face a critical dilemma: should they continue maintaining their legacy systems or transition to modern cloud infrastructure? Legacy systems-typically defined as outdated computing software or hardware still in use-can be deeply embedded in a company’s operations. While these systems may have been state-of-the-art at the time of implementation, their limitations are becoming increasingly apparent in today’s fast-paced digital economy.
Legacy systems often serve as the backbone of critical business functions, from financial processing to customer relationship management. However, these systems can present significant challenges, including rising maintenance costs, integration difficulties, and limited scalability. For instance, a survey by Deloitte found that 60% of IT executives reported that maintaining legacy systems consumes more than 50% of their IT budget. This statistic highlights the substantial financial strain these systems impose, prompting many businesses to reconsider their technology strategies sooner rather than later.
Beyond costs, legacy systems can hinder innovation. Their outdated architectures often lack compatibility with newer applications and technologies, making it difficult to implement digital transformation initiatives. This incompatibility can slow down product development, reduce operational agility, and ultimately impact a company’s competitive edge in the market.

The financial implications of holding onto old technology
One of the primary reasons companies hesitate to replace legacy systems is the perceived high upfront cost of transitioning to new technology. The immediate expenses associated with software licensing, infrastructure upgrades, and employee training can be daunting. However, the ongoing expenses associated with legacy infrastructure often far exceed these initial investments.
Maintenance fees for legacy systems tend to increase over time, as hardware ages and software vendors phase out support. Organizations frequently face escalating labor costs due to the need for specialized knowledge to troubleshoot and repair these systems. Moreover, reliance on scarce expert resources can lead to bottlenecks and delays in resolving technical issues.
Security vulnerabilities further add to the cost burden. Older systems may lack the latest security patches, leaving organizations exposed to cyber threats. According to the Ponemon Institute, the average cost of a data breach in companies relying on outdated systems is 2.7 times higher than those using modern platforms. This increased risk not only affects IT budgets but can also damage brand reputation and customer trust.
Operational inefficiencies are another hidden cost. Legacy systems often lack the scalability and flexibility required to respond to changing market demands. Downtime caused by system failures can disrupt business continuity and negatively impact customer satisfaction, indirectly affecting revenue streams. Gartner predicts that by 2025, 75% of organizations will have fully migrated or initiated migration to cloud environments to avoid legacy system pitfalls. This trend underscores the growing recognition that holding onto old technology can be prohibitively expensive in the long run.
The advantages of modern cloud infrastructure
Cloud computing has revolutionized the way businesses manage and deploy their IT resources. Unlike legacy systems, cloud infrastructure offers unparalleled flexibility, scalability, and cost efficiency. By leveraging cloud services, companies can reduce their capital expenditure on hardware and shift to a pay-as-you-go model, optimizing operational expenses.
One of the most significant benefits of cloud adoption is agility. Cloud platforms enable rapid deployment of applications and services, allowing businesses to respond quickly to market changes and customer demands. Additionally, cloud infrastructure supports advanced technologies such as artificial intelligence, machine learning, and big data analytics, which can drive innovation and enhance decision-making.
Improved disaster recovery capabilities and enhanced security features are other key advantages. Cloud providers invest heavily in securing their environments and complying with regulatory standards, often exceeding what individual organizations can achieve on their own. According to Flexera’s 2023 State of the Cloud Report, 92% of enterprises have a multi-cloud strategy, underscoring the widespread recognition of cloud’s strategic value. Multi-cloud approaches also help mitigate risks by avoiding vendor lock-in and enhancing resilience.
Overcoming challenges in cloud migration
Transitioning from legacy systems to cloud infrastructure is not without its challenges. Data migration complexities, potential downtime during the switch, and ensuring compliance with industry regulations are common concerns that can cause hesitation.
Data migration requires meticulous planning to avoid loss or corruption. Legacy data formats and structures may not easily translate to cloud environments, necessitating data cleansing and transformation efforts. Furthermore, downtime during migration can disrupt business operations if not carefully managed.
Security and compliance are critical considerations. Organizations must ensure that cloud deployments meet regulatory requirements such as GDPR, HIPAA, or PCI DSS, depending on their industry. This often involves implementing robust access controls, encryption, and continuous monitoring.

When legacy systems become too costly to maintain
Determining the tipping point at which legacy technology becomes too expensive to keep is crucial for strategic planning. This decision often involves evaluating a range of factors, including:
- Annual maintenance and support costs
- Compatibility with current and future business needs
- Security risks and compliance issues
- Impact on employee productivity and morale
- Ability to scale and integrate with new technologies
Companies must perform a comprehensive cost-benefit analysis that weighs these aspects against the benefits of modernizing their IT infrastructure. This analysis should also consider intangible costs such as lost innovation opportunities and the risk of falling behind competitors.

Making the case for strategic IT investment
Leadership teams must communicate the strategic value of IT modernization to stakeholders effectively. Demonstrating how cloud infrastructure supports business goals-such as faster product development, enhanced customer experiences, and improved operational efficiency-can build consensus for necessary investments.
Adopting a phased approach to modernization is often the most practical strategy. Starting with non-critical systems allows organizations to gain confidence, demonstrate quick wins, and refine processes before tackling core legacy applications. This incremental method reduces risk and spreads costs over time.
Additionally, involving cross-functional teams in planning and execution ensures that modernization efforts align with broader organizational priorities and user needs. Transparency around risks, benefits, timelines, and expected outcomes helps maintain stakeholder engagement and support.
